    At the top end of cash and im talking about 100 nl and above, there are lots of competant regs and a few world class players. Anything below that and the standard is generally worse than other sites. 

    I dont consider myself a reg at nl40/50, but I dont feel uncomfortable playing at this level on sky because other players make fundamental mistakes which are exploitable. On stars I wont play cash, because as soon as you get to a meaningful level you have regs on every table. 

    MTTs on sky again are soft, generally the cash players prevail in the deepstacks and theres a reason for that. I havent played a meaningful amount of me's on sky because they finish way too late for us working folk.

    Over 5 years the standard has gone up a lot. Back then a competent player would not have to worry about variance in tournaments. Playing standard ABC and relying on others to make mistakes was enough.

    Now there are many more good players around, and a lot of guys who have the game to beat an ABC player.

    But there are always new players coming to the site and so we have a wide range of ability.
